How to Fix Proton-GE Not Detecting Steam on Linux

Comments · 119 Views

Is Proton GE not showing up in Steam on Linux? Here’s how to fix detection issues quickly and get your Windows games running smoothly again.

 

Introduction

If you use Proton GE to play Windows games on Linux, you might sometimes face an issue where Steam fails to detect it properly. This can prevent certain games from launching or using the correct compatibility layer. Don’t worry  this is a common issue and can usually be fixed with a few quick adjustments. In this article, we’ll show you how to fix Proton-GE not detecting Steam on Linux and get everything working perfectly again.

1. Understanding the Problem

Proton GE (Glorious Eggroll) is a custom version of Proton that improves performance and compatibility for Steam games on Linux. If Steam isn’t detecting Proton GE, it usually means one of two things: either the installation folder is incorrect, or Steam hasn’t refreshed its compatibility tools. Occasionally, missing configurations or file naming issues can also cause the detection problem.

2. Check Where Proton GE Is Installed

The most common cause of Steam not detecting Proton-GE is an incorrect installation path. Proton GE should be placed in the compatibility tools directory inside your Steam folder.
If the folder doesn’t exist, create one manually and move your extracted Proton GE files into it. After that, restart Steam to let it detect the new compatibility tool.

3. Enable Proton GE in Steam Settings

Once the files are in the right place, open Steam and go to Settings → Steam Play.
Here’s what to do:

  • Make sure Steam Play for all titles is enabled.
  • Open the Proton version dropdown and choose Proton GE from the list.

If Proton GE doesn’t appear, restart Steam again or double check the folder name to ensure it matches the version number exactly (for example, Proton GE Proton9 16).

4. Refresh Steam’s Compatibility Tools

If Steam still doesn’t detect Proton GE, try refreshing its internal compatibility data. This can be done by restarting Steam completely or logging out and back in. Steam will then automatically scan and update its compatibility tools, helping it detect any new Proton GE installations.

5. Reinstall or Update Proton GE

Sometimes an outdated or corrupted installation causes the issue. The easiest fix is to delete your current Proton GE folder and download the latest version from the official Glorious Eggroll GitHub page. Extract it again into the correct folder, then restart Steam.

Newer releases of Proton GE often include fixes for detection problems and improved performance for newer games.

Conclusion

Fixing Proton GE not detecting Steam on Linux is usually simple  it’s often just a matter of checking the installation path, refreshing Steam, or updating to the latest Proton GE version. Once properly set up, Proton GE enhances performance, boosts compatibility, and ensures a smoother gaming experience on Linux. Keep your version up to date, and your Steam library will run almost as smoothly as it does on Windows.

 

Comments